Skip to content

Commit 04baf58

Browse files
committed
Fix dependencies in manual makefile
- also build in parallel using the manual makefile
1 parent 0c50e78 commit 04baf58

File tree

2 files changed

+14
-2
lines changed

2 files changed

+14
-2
lines changed

.github/workflows/CI.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-82,7 +82,7 @@ jobs:
8282
- name: Test manual makefiles
8383
if: contains(matrix.os, 'ubuntu') && contains(matrix.gcc_v, '10')
8484
run: |
85-
make -f Makefile.manual FYPPFLAGS="-DMAXRANK=4"
85+
make -f Makefile.manual FYPPFLAGS="-DMAXRANK=4" -j
8686
make -f Makefile.manual test
8787
make -f Makefile.manual clean
8888

src/Makefile.manual

Lines changed: 13 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-54,10 +54,16 @@ stdlib_io.o: \
5454
stdlib_error.o \
5555
stdlib_optval.o \
5656
stdlib_kinds.o
57-
stdlib_linalg_diag.o: stdlib_kinds.o
57+
stdlib_linalg_diag.o: \
58+
stdlib_linalg.o \
59+
stdlib_kinds.o
5860
stdlib_logger.o: stdlib_ascii.o stdlib_optval.o
5961
stdlib_optval.o: stdlib_kinds.o
6062
stdlib_quadrature.o: stdlib_kinds.o
63+
stdlib_quadrature_trapzd.o: \
64+
stdlib_error.o \
65+
stdlib_quadrature.o \
66+
stdlib_kinds.o
6167
stdlib_stats_mean.o: \
6268
stdlib_optval.o \
6369
stdlib_kinds.o \
@@ -66,6 +72,12 @@ stdlib_stats_moment.o: \
6672
stdlib_optval.o \
6773
stdlib_kinds.o \
6874
stdlib_stats.o
75+
stdlib_stats_moment_all.o: \
76+
stdlib_stats_moment.o
77+
stdlib_stats_moment_mask.o: \
78+
stdlib_stats_moment.o
79+
stdlib_stats_moment_scalar.o: \
80+
stdlib_stats_moment.o
6981
stdlib_stats_var.o: \
7082
stdlib_optval.o \
7183
stdlib_kinds.o \

0 commit comments

Comments
 (0)